A method of measuring the charges on single raindrops and snowflakes is stated. The method by a vacuum tube electrometer is simple, and is suited very well for field observations under thunderstorm or snowfall, using the method, charges on single raindrops and snowflakes were observed throughout 1954 and 1956 at Kiryu, Yokohama and Sapporo, simultaneously with their sizes and electric field intensity.
Following results are obtained,
a) Under active thunder clouds, a definite reverse relation exists between the sign of the charge on precipitation elements and that of the surface field, except during a short period when the sign of field changes.
b) During a quiet rainfall or snowfall, the field sign does not change, but the reverse relation is still observed. On the basis of the results, it is considered that only when the field intensity under the cloud base is large compared with the charge on precipitation elements within the clouds, the falling elements suffer a change in charge as a result of selective ion capture according to Wilson's induction mechanism, obtaining the charge of different sign from that of the surface field.
